Youth Ministry

Our Youth programs combine monthly activities, retreats, and service projects.

We have five youth groups:

Red Basket Kids, age 3-grade 3;  Acolytes, grades 4-6;   Confirmands, grades 7-8;

High School, grades 9-12; and GRADS, post high school

Pastoral Care

Our parish is divided into twelve geographic clusters.  This helps us care for each other and support our phone chain.  Our clusters gather in Advent and Lent for Cluster devotions. 

Visitation is an important part of our parish.  Everyone is special.  Special days and events in the lives of our people are recognized and celebrated.

Outreach

Every two months the parish is involved in an outreach activity such as collecting household goods for the local shelters or raising money for world hunger.

Each year the Sunday Church School selects a project.  In the past the children have selected Habitat for Humanity, the heifer Project, and ELCA special projects.
